JACOBS, SR. v. McCLEESE


266 A.D.2d 265 (1999)

698 N.Y.S.2d 522

SAM JACOBS, SR., Appellant, v. DANA McCLEESE et al., Defendants, and PROFILE RECORDS, INC., et al., Respondents.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

Decided November 8, 1999.


Ordered that the order is affirmed, with costs.

The agreement between the plaintiff Sam Jacobs, Sr., and the defendants Profile Records, Inc., and Protoons Publishing, Inc. (hereinafter collectively Profile), allowed Profile to contract directly with singer Dana McCleese in the event that the plaintiff defaulted on his agreement with Profile.
